Original Medicare is made up of two fundamental parts; Part An and Part B. Medicare part A comprises all hospital expenses, including hospital stays and any other expense and that be incurred inside a hospital. Medicare Part B covers any expenses that happen in the office of a physician ; outpatient surgeries, such as MRIs, Ct Scans, Etc. Collectively B & Medicare part A make-up initial Medicare. This really is what everybody on Medicare has.
Medicare will not cover 100% of your medical bills. Medicare covers about 80% of medical expenses. This leaves the remaining 20% that isn’t insured. As folks get mature health problems can appear and more medical bills can be incurred. With merely Medicare and no Medigap or Medicare Supplement Plan you can confront a large bill that is 20% of the total invoice. 20% of a statement that is very big is still a very large bill. This is why many people choose to get a Medicare Supplement Plan to help protect them against the high cost that can happen from other medical expense or a hospital stay.
Overview Of Medigap Plans
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ans. These plans are controlled by the US government Medicare and are designed to work with First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are does not cover in full (the 20% that is left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a plan letter A-N. Because the plans are standardized and regulated, the benefits are the same no matter what company is offering the Medigap insurance. The only difference between an identical plan letter with different companies is the cost. By way of example, a Plan F with Aetna and a Plan F with AARP are just the same the only difference between them is the cost that the insurance companies charge.. .. Medicare Supplement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is one of the very popular supplement plans. This plan covers 100% of everything that is left over by Original Medicare. For example, F covers the Part A deductible, all hospital bills, and whatever happens in any other medical facility at 100% or a doctor ‘s office. This can be the only plan that offers 100% complete coverage that is complete.
Medigap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a plan we like to urge the most and frequently referred to as the Gold Plan. It’s virtually identical to Plan F. The only difference is an annual de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the gains are just the same as Plan F. The reason we like Plan G is because the premiums are substantially less than Plan F.
Medigap Insurance Plan N
Medicare Supplement Plan N is the third most popular choice and it’s in regards to some of the other Medicare Supplement Plans not dissimilar.. .. This plan is not bad for individuals who would love to enjoy a premium that is lower have nearly total coverage at the hospital and other high medical bills that can happen.

When Is The Best Time To Buy A Medicare Supplement Plan?
When you’re first eligible for Medicare; during your open enrollment for Medigap the best time to purchase Medicare Supplement Plan is. During this time which begins six months before your 65th birthday and last for half a year after your 65th birthday you are able to sign up no matter your health for a Medicare Supplement Plan. There aren’t any questions for pre-existing states and you can get any Medigap plan you need from any carrier
If you are past the age of 65 and looking get an agenda for the first time or to change plans you may have to answer some fundamental health questions to qualify. Most folks and qualify so you still ought to be able to get a insurance plan.
